The Church Brew Works opened in 1996 as the first brewery in a closed Church in North America. Since that time about 40 more closed churches have been adapted for brewpubs and tap rooms.
This is an original photo used on the back cover of brewpub magazine.
CBW designed the tanks to have copper banding at top and in the middle of the tanks and a reverse stainless steel banding on our copper clad brew kettles. This innovative look swept tank design and became a design feature on other showcase breweries for years to come.
The photo was taken by Priscilla Briggs who was a talented young teacher at Manchester craftsmen guild and a friend of the founders of CBW. People would ask what software did you use to make this photo look that way? Our answer was huh...that is the real photo.
The tank mfg was specific mchanical systems out of Victoria Island British Columbia. They made stainless tanks for the fishing industry in the pacific Northwest for fishing vessels and started to make beer tanks.
We worked closely with Blaine Clouston and Ray Freeman to customize this brewhouse and worked with Aaron Fedarko at Allegheny Ludlum Steel to use Pittsburgh rolled steel.
30 Years ago our country produced 42" wide stainless so the banding on our tanks was used to cover up the welds in the mfg process.
CBW asked Specific to split the costs of our photo to for use of this add. They were a bit nervous but said yes. When we asked for $150 which was half of the $300 costs, they were baffled and confused how low the price of the photo was. Lots of friends helped in the begining on low budgets to help the project get up including Jessi and Monte, J Lesko, Pumper Katz, the fulton family, architect off record Mike Maise who was part time bartender on Tory hill and later was the lead designer of the first Apple Store, Cris Fulton, Uncle Dave Casey who refinished all the wood flors and other friends and family. We opened the pub for Burghers and not tourists...(as the city had nominal tourism 30 years ago). We still strive to serve Burghers first but have had visistors from around the world. Help Keep Con Alma's Doors Open

Con Alma was born from a vision to give Pittsburgh’s jazz scene a true home—a place where music, food, and community come together in a way that’s both immersive and unique. We set out to create an environment unlike any other in the city, with vinyl records spinning, no TV screens to distract from the vibe, and a focus on high-level food and cocktails. Since opening our doors in June 2019, we’ve poured our hearts into making Con Alma a cultural hub for jazz lovers and the restaurant community alike.

But just as we were finding our rhythm, COVID-19 hit in March 2020, forcing us into survival mode. We fought to keep the music alive and our team together, even as the world changed around us. In 2021, we took a leap and opened a second location downtown, hoping to expand our reach. Unfortunately, keeping both locations open for too long stretched us thin, and the financial strain began to take its toll. Even after closing our Shadyside location, the debts and challenges kept piling up. In this industry, one slow week can threaten everything, and one slow month can be devastating. Despite outward appearances, we’ve been fighting to stay above water, and the threat of closing our doors has never felt more real.

We’ve tried to raise funds before, but unexpected setbacks stopped us short. Now, after years of hard work and dedication, we’re turning to you—our community—for help. The funds we raise will go directly toward paying back taxes, settling debts, securing payroll, and covering the countless expenses that keep Con Alma running. This funding will allow us to achieve more stability for the first time in years, and we will then be able to continue to develop Con Alma’s authentic vision.

We believe in what Con Alma stands for and the space it holds in Pittsburgh’s cultural landscape. We are deeply grateful for the support we’ve received so far, and we humbly ask for your help to keep the music playing and the doors open.
